Relationships

v Work in: Photographer Section [1:n]

Description: this relation helps users to view Sections in which photographer works

Motivation: while looking works of photographer a customer can easily browse the sections, which represent the same works

 

v Represented by: Section Photographer [1:n]

Description: this relation helps users to view all list of photographers represented by this section

Motivation: user should probably be interested in photographers of this section

 

v Described in: Photographer Article [0:n]

Description: this relation helps users to view all articles, which represent photographer

Motivation: for more detailed description of special photographer works or awards, users can visit articles

 

v Written about: Article Photographer [0:n]

Description: this relation allows a user to read about photographer

Motivation: while reading article user can easily browse the more detailed information about photographer

 

v Written about: Article Project [0:1]

Description: this relation helps users to view project, which about article was written

Motivation: user should probably be interested to view of the project, which described in article

 

v Described by: Project Article[0:n]

Description: this relation allows a user to read about project in article

Motivation: user should probably be interested to view of the project, which described in article

 

v Created by: Project Photographer [1:n]

Description: this relation helps users to view photographers, who created project

Motivation: while viewing a project user can easily browse the more detailed information about creaters

 

v Create: Photographer Project [0:n]

Description: this relation allows a user to view all project created by photographer

Motivation: for more detailed information about photographer’s works, users can visit Project

 

v Belong to: Award Photographer [1:1]

Description: this relation allows a user to read about photographer

Motivation: while reading about award user can easily browse the more detailed information about photographer
